Persons who fail to take immediate action to abate a <br /> fire or life safety hazard when ordered or notified to do so by the chief or a <br /> duly authorized representative are guilty of a misdemeanor. <br /> Section 18. Division 2 Amendments of Chapter 14, including Sections 14-17 through <br /> 14-80, of the Santa Ana Municipal Code is hereby deleted in its entirety and amended to read <br /> as follows: <br /> Sec. 14-17 Chapter 2 Definitions —amendments <br /> Chapter 2 DEFINITIONS is adopted in its entirety as amended by the SFM with the <br /> following amendments: <br /> Sections 202 GENERAL DEFINITIONS is hereby revised by adding "OCFA" and "Spark <br /> Arrester" as follows: <br /> OCFA._Orange County Fire Authority, authority having jurisdiction. <br /> SPARK ARRESTER. A listed device constructed of noncombustible material <br /> specifically for the purpose of meeting one of the following conditions: <br /> 1. Removing and retaining carbon and other flammable particles/debris from <br /> combustion engine in accordance with <br /> the exhaust flow of an internal c, <br /> California Vehicle Code Section 38366. <br /> 2. Fireplaces that burn solid fuel in accordance with California Building Code <br /> Chapter 28. <br /> Sec. 14-18 Chapter 3 General Requirements— amendments <br /> Chapter 3 GENERAL REQUIREMENTS is adopted in only those sections and <br /> subsections adopted by the SFM with the following amendments: <br /> Section 304.1.3 Vegetation is hereby revised as follows: <br /> 304.1.3 Vegetation.
